In this training, Dr. Grant will provide an overview of what trauma is, how it impacts the brain, and why different strategies for behavior management are often needed for consistent success. Strategies for supporting regulation and managing common behavioral concerns for this population will be presented. While strategies for more escalated out of classroom management will be covered, more focus will be placed on strategies that can be used in the classroom and around other students with minimized disruptions. Attendees will leave with a better understanding of how and why these students function as they do and with several practical strategies that can be immediately used in the classroom.
Learning Objectives
Participants will learn at least 2 ways trauma impacts neurology.
Participants will what happens when a brain is "triggered".
Participants will learn ways to identify through observation what level of stress a student is at
Participants will learn at least 2 strategies for managing crisis behaviors.
Participants will learn at least 2 strategies for managing non-crisis disruptive behaviors.
Participants will learn at least 2 strategies for supporting regulation and preventing disruptive behaviors.
